Accident: 200754422 - Employee Drowns When Pinned Underwater By Overturned Mower

Accident: 200754422 -- Report ID: 0522500 -- Event Date: 07/24/2002
InspectionOpen DateSICEstablishment Name
30542803907/24/20027997The Golf Club

On July 24, 2002, Employee #1 was using a riding mower to cut the rough on the 16th hole of a golf course. He drove too close to the edge of a hill and the lawnmower overturned into a water hazard. The riding mower pinned Employee #1 underneath the water and he drowned.
